In 1977, a nurse saved a badly burned baby. 38 years later, she spots an old photo of herself on the social media and is stunned.

At just 3 months old, Amanda Scarpinati suffered severe burns after falling onto a steam vaporizer. She was treated at Albany Medical Center in 1977, where a kind nurse, Sue Berger, comforted her through the pain.

All Amanda had were photos of herself as a bandaged baby in Nurse Berger’s arms. Years later, after enduring bullying over her scars and undergoing many surgeries, she posted the photos on Facebook in hopes of finding the nurse who had shown her such compassion.
